Description

Premier Snares Drums The Premier Artist 12″ x 6″ Birch Snare Drum offers a balanced sound with a deeper fuller tone and more resonance than smaller snares thanks to its larger diameter and depth. It delivers a sharp punchy attack with moderate sustain making it versatile for both live and studio use where a robust snare presence is needed. The 7.5mm 6-ply birch shell delivers a balanced focused sound with richness and fullness in tone resonance and durability while providing a bright punchy tone with quick attack good projection and shorter sustain making it ideal for cutting through mixes. The 20-strand snare wire offers a balanced sound that combines crisp snare response with the natural tone of the drum. 1.5mm triple-flange drum hoops offer a more open and resonant sound that gives the drum a more natural expressive sound. Finished in an Antique Ash outer ash veneer with chrome hardware and Premiers iconic P badge this snare is a perfect addition to any drummers setup. The included 12″ x 6″ Snare Drum Soft Case makes it easy to transport store and protect your drum with confidence. A 20mm thick padded interior keeps it shielded from knocks while red Premier piping and an embroidered logo bring standout style. With its snug fit durable handle and adjustable strap it?s a smart secure way to move your snare wherever it needs to go.

Drums are the rhythmic backbone of modern music, providing pulse, energy, and structure across countless styles and genres. From acoustic drum kits and marching drums to hand percussion and electronic systems, drums are designed to be played physically and expressively, responding directly to touch, technique, and dynamics.

Acoustic drums are built from shells, heads, and hardware that work together to shape tone, volume, and sustain. Different sizes, materials, and tunings allow drummers to create sounds ranging from deep and powerful to tight and articulate. Electronic drums expand this further by offering volume control, sound variety, and integration with recording and digital music systems.

Drums are used in live performance, recording, education, and practice, making them one of the most versatile instrument families in music. Whether played softly or with force, alone or as part of a full band, drums play a central role in driving rhythm, supporting musicians, and shaping the feel of a piece of music.

Snare Drum

A snare drum provides clarity, backbeat, and definition within a drum kit, acting as the main voice for timing and accents. Its tight head and metal snares create a sharp, responsive sound that cuts through a mix, making it essential for groove, dynamics, and rhythmic punctuation. The snare drum controls feel and expression, allowing drummers to play everything from soft ghost notes to powerful backbeats that drive the music.
